Hi Sascha,
I've pulled it into the imx/move branch, to be merged through the next/move
branch in arm-soc now.
Sorry for not replying earlier. I think the best plan is to do it at the
end of a merge window, but I didn't feel comfortable at the end of the
3.2-rc1 because I had not seen the patches before.
Since almost all the files are trivially moved, I think we can best avoid
all merge conflicts by applying the move changeset last after all other
changes to mx5 code have gone in. I'll gladly take care of regenerating
the patch before I send it (and letting you double-check the result).
However, what I'd like you to do is minimize the changes that don't
just move entire files around by submitting them as a cleanup branch
that I can apply *before* all other patches. I think we should have
separate patches for these changes:
* merge mach-mx5/system.c into pm-imx5.c
* merge arch/arm/mach-mx5/Kconfig into arch/arm/mach-imx/Kconfig
* ARM i.MX5: remove unnecessary includes from board files
If we do these early, the remaining move will be even more trivial
than the current series.
